UNFOLDING REASONING CASE
STUDY HEART FAILURE JOANN
SMITH 72 YEARS ACTUAL
QUESTIONS ANSWERS GRADED

⩥ Which assessment finding provides the earliest indication that the
client is experiencing right-sided heart failure? Answer: Peripheral
edema.


⩥ Based on the electrocardiogram rhythm strip, what intervention
should the nurse implement first? Answer: Obtain a 12 lead ECG.


⩥ After the client's cardiac rhythm is confirmed, which action should the
nurse implement next? Answer: Administer an ordered stat dose of
digoxin.


⩥ When preparing the client for the echocardiogram, which intervention
should the nurse implement? Answer: Ask the client to lay supine during
the test


⩥ The RN charge nurse prepares a dose of digoxin 0.125 mg IV push.
The medication is supplied as 0.25 mg in 2 mL. How many mL should
the RN prepare to give? (Enter numeric value only. If rounding is
necessary, round to the whole number.) Answer: 1

, ⩥ After administration of the prescribed captopril, which assessment
finding warrants intervention by the nurse? Answer: Decrease in
baseline blood pressure.


⩥ The nurse is monitoring the client's serum electrolytes. Which of the
client's serum laboratory values requires intervention by the nurse?
Answer: Potassium 3.0 mEq/L (3.0 mmol/L).


⩥ The client is concerned about how easily they are bruising since they
started taking the warfarin. Which intervention is most important for the
nurse to include in the client's plan of care? Answer: Monitor INR levels
every 4-6 weeks.


⩥ The nurse observed a family member bringing the client food from
home. Which intervention is most important for the nurse implement?
Answer: Teach the client and his family what foods are low in sodium.


⩥ The client asks the nurse why they have to be weighed every day. The
nurse explains that weight gain is one of the first signs of retaining fluid.
Which intervention is most important for the nurse to include in the
client's plan of care? Answer: Report a gain of 3 pounds in one week.


⩥ What is the first action that the nurse should implement when entering
the client's room? Answer: Elevate the head of the client's bed.
